"A monotype is a unique, one-of-a-kind printmaking technique that results in a single, original image. An artist (such as Kellyann Monaghan) applies ink or paint to a smooth, non-absorbent surface, like glass, metal, or plexiglass. The artist then presses the plate against paper to transfer the image. Because each monotype is hand-executed and unique, it can't be replicated like other printmaking techniques. The pigment left on the plate is usually not enough to make another print, and any subsequent prints will differ from the original." Monotypes are considered a painterly form of print making which you can clearly see soft lines and shapes of Skylight II by Monaghan.
